Transaction 96e72fb1112ddfe531d57369760b4f1504a0243359c931a7ec2ae234b82752c0
2 Input
2 Outputs
- 96e72fb1112ddfe531d57369760b4f1504a0243359c931a7ec2ae234b82752c0:0
- 96e72fb1112ddfe531d57369760b4f1504a0243359c931a7ec2ae234b82752c0:1
value 1101505
address 1E5J1gmM3Sb9RhctaSRtqB7NTnxLBftpb
value 160779
address 14s2LhktebKhvuiSSfQyXoqSEt3ncy7fXc